              delahoya can still let his hands go and put nice combo together like few in the sport today, but he doesn't seem to have the same bounce in his legs, and at times he was hesitant to throw where as before he'd throw at least jabs, he fought mayorga very similar in the way he fought mosley in their first fight, i would have like to see if delahoya still had his legs but he didn't use them

              mayweather more likely will be on his bicycle and out box delahoya, margarito would be too much of a war for delahoya to go through at this stage in his career
